WATERTOWN, Wisc. – The Trine University men's volleyball team returned from a more than two week hiatus with a convincing three set win over Maranatha Baptist on Friday night. Trine (10-8, 2-1 MCVL) nailed 10 aces and 42 kills on the night to power past the Sabercats (0-17).
 
John Mikrut led Trine with eight kills and a pair of aces while Ty Freeman was excellent on the serve with a trio of aces. Trine took the match 25-20, 25-15, 25-19
 
Trine used a 9-4 run to pull away from MBU in the first set. Bryce Tupaz had a pair of aces and Chase Emberton added two kills. Zach Mikrut put the set away with an ace.
 
Trine hit .333 in the second set and wasted little time building an insurmountable lead, scoring the first eight points, Mikrut heated up with three of his kills and Freeman served all eight points and had two aces. Trine led by as many as 13 before claiming the win.
 
MBU returned the favor in the third set, scoring the first five points. The Thunder quickly rallied to a 12-9 lead with help from Austin Pflunger. He had three kills and an ace. Pflunger and Ryan Ford each added two more swings to help Trine clinch the sweep.
 
Trine is back in action tomorrow afternoon at North Park University. The match is set for a first serve at 4:00 p.m.
